Tips for Safe Use & Getting the Most from Strength Trainers
To use Strength Trainers safely and effectively:
- Warm up before training
- Use controlled movements
- Avoid jerky or forced motion
- Increase resistance gradually
- Maintain correct posture
- Rest between training sessions
Correct training habits protect joints and maximize strength gains.
Care & Maintenance of Strength Trainers
To maintain your Strength Trainers:
- Clean after each use
- Store resistance bands away from heat
- Inspect grip trainers for wear
- Check elasticity regularly
- Replace damaged equipment promptly
Proper care ensures durability, safety, and hygiene.
